Job Role:

Working for a Electrical Simulation Power Systems group who support the activities on projects across the UK on utility networks, industrial electrical infrastructure and plant electrical installations.

The role requires the undertaking of design activities, studies, proposals and technical support. The work entails the ability to work to programme commitments and to work concurrently on a number of live projects at differing stages of development and execution.

The majority of time will be office based in the North West but with a requirement to travel to meetings with clients, manufacturers and DNO's and to attend project sites as required. A good commercial awareness is also necessary.

Job Requirements:

Preferably Degree qualified in Electrical Engineering with a good knowledge of Electrical Power networks and systems design at Medium Voltage and Low Voltage.

The majority of network design is at 11/33kV under ICP design provisions and candidates should be conversant with DNO design procedures. Good knowledge of Industrial Electrical systems design covering switchgear, transformers, relay panels, substations and process plant systems

Produce Electrical design drawings using AutoCad. Drawings will comprise: Single Line Diagrams, Schematic Diagrams, Termination Diagrams, Electrical/Civil Layouts for Substations, Transformer pens, Switchrooms etc., Cable Routing, Earthing, LVAC Services and Electrical detailing

Produce Outline and detailed Calculations for Power Systems Studies comprising: Load Flow, Fault Level, Protection Settings, Transient Stability using industry standard software: IPSA, Power Factory, PowerNet.

Produce MV and LV cable calculations, reports and schedules. Produce Earthing calculations and reports. Produce LVAC systems designs and calculations.

Produce Technical Specifications and Plant/Equipment/Relay Schedules.

Produce Contractor Proposals packages for projects.

Review manufacturer's proposals against project requirement specifications.

Undertake FAT and SAT witness testing duties and schedule commissioning technical requirements for electrical switchgear, transformers, relay schemes, AVR schemes etc.

Able to manage engineering support staff
